TransformingTransport: Steering Group Met in Essen

On March 15 and 16, 2018, the steering group of the European lighthouse project TransformingTransport met at paluno in Essen.

The project members presented their results from the individual subprojects and coordinated the next steps. Scientists from the research group of Prof. Dr. Klaus Pohl presented a prototype of the productivity cockpit they are developing together with the Port of Duisburg. The real-time data provided by the productivity cockpit makes it easier to monitor and control the processes in the terminal.
